The trade-off is that it is not for toilets. Many people mistakenly think a drain cleaner can fix a toilet clog, but the heat generated by the chemical reaction can actually crack the porcelain. If you prefer a more biological approach to plumbing, Green Gobbler Enzyme Drain Cleaner is a fascinating alternative to caustic gels. Instead of burning through a clog with chemicals, it uses enzymes and bacteria to “eat” organic material like fats, oils, and paper. It stands out because it is septic-safe and actually improves the health of your septic tank or grease trap over time rather than just clearing a single pipe.

This is the ideal choice for homeowners on septic systems or business owners managing grease traps. It’s a one-gallon bulk bottle, so it’s built for long-term maintenance rather than a one-time fix. If you struggle with recurring foul odors from your sewer lines, the enzymatic action is much better at neutralizing those smells at the biological source.

The main downside is speed. This is not a “seven-minute” fix. Because it relies on natural processes, it can take several hours or even overnight to see results. If you have an emergency overflow right now, this isn’t the product to reach for; it’s a slow-and-steady solution for long-term flow.

Buying Guide

Buying Guide: Best drain cleaner for soap scum

Effectiveness

  • Look for formulas that dissolve soap scum and mineral deposits
  • Check if the product targets hair, grease, and organic buildup
  • Prioritize fast-acting solutions for severe clogs

Pipe Safety

  • Choose products with non-corrosive ingredients
  • Verify compatibility with septic systems
  • Ensure safety for PVC, metal, and fiberglass pipes

Ease of Use

  • Opt for gel or foam formulas that cling to surfaces
  • Check if scrubbing or repeated applications are required
  • Consider pre-mixed solutions for convenience

Environmental Impact

  • Select EPA Safer Choice Certified or enzyme-based options
  • Avoid harsh chemicals like bleach or ammonia
  • Look for biodegradable or non-toxic formulas

Value & Quantity

  • Compare price per fluid ounce for cost-effectiveness
  • Assess concentration for long-term use
  • Check if refill options are available
